HomeMy WebLinkAbout1958-07-10 Sele~tmens Meeting ' 10 July 1958 ~- ,~ ~The meeting came to order at 8.25 PM having been prec'eeded by , by a Coudty Commissioners meeting. Warrant No. 28; tot.alling~$48,554.69 was pr'esented by Town Acct. Barrett and checked and approved,by the Board. Minutes ,of the previous meeting were approved. Mr. Parker Gray was present and requested that the Board ~ive consideration to the matter of ~llowing him to keep his place of business open after the closing hour for selling alcoholic beverages, in order~to sell food. This-matter was discussed by the Board in executive S~ession and it was Voted that no change be made in the existing regulations as to closing hours. Mr. Joh~ Golden was present and gave a report in behalf of the Public relations .committee for the past month, stated that business~was off both here and on the other island and the cape, probably attributable-to the bad weather we have been having. , Mr. J~esse Bldridge, caretaker of the Scon~s~t Comfort station was present ,and discussed with the Board painting necessary at the comfort station. Mr. Eldridge was authroize to purchase 'the necessay materials to do this work. He also advised 'that one of the outside doors was in very poor shape~and should be replaced and stated that he had contacted three carpenters and'obtained figures a~_follows for this job: . Albert Bgan & Sons -60.25; Pete Lyons'68.00 -Mike Lamb 54.8~ this included providing a door an8 hardware and priming and painting 'two co~ts. The matter was left with the Secy to determinte from Mr. Putterick if we had any suitable doors available and if not to authroize the lowest-bidder Mr. Lamb to do this work. Mr. Lane Mann, lifeguard at the Childrens ~each was present ~to meet the members of the Board. Mr. Marcus Ramsdell was present 'and complained a~out the con- dition of the Warrens Landing road. Mr. Barrett stated that he had talked with Mr. John-Kittila of the mosquito con- trol commission and that he was going to put'in a tile to 'drain the,Dr. W~kt~ salt meadow and that if this~were done 4 or 5 lo'ads of fill in the low spot in-the road would-co- rrect the situation. Mr. Jaeckle Supt. of streets stated ,that he 'felt this was all that was necessary_ and the road is passable now and needs no great amohnt of work. Mr. Robert Gilbreth was present to discuss the matter of the Dioness beach, arriving'after the county commissioner meeting had adjourned. The Board discussed the problem with Mr.~Gilbreth but felt there'was nothing we could do at this time to provide access to the beach over the high bank, .the board was opposed to bulldozing any of the bank away and felt that we should examine the area with a veiw to putting an article in the annual warrant to construct a few sets of steps at, stratigis "locations on the town park land where the bank is high. ~ Contracts for the maintenance of the state highway for~the next six months were received from the DPW and signed by the Board. ~ It was voted to approve~the ,installation of a sign at the Be~ach~ street end of Harbor view way.
